Output 59f61400401c10050f512549730b6bc8f3236c37ee96de58a34e7a8ab7ae0507:0

value
1531345050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d3e2055531f85319b0f1659c400c7b3750362c7 OP_EQUAL
address
A9gtoFrD9g9WrmBVLLDEHD5FbdraNzJvea
transaction
59f61400401c10050f512549730b6bc8f3236c37ee96de58a34e7a8ab7ae0507